    One thing I personally like to do, especially on a course I’ve never played before, is to play from the front or next-to-front tees. My driver has been 50/50 in recent months due to a driver change and the shorter distance lets me hit a long iron or my 3-wood into fairways with ease. I’m consistently scoring in the low-mid 80’s when I do this, which upsets my playing partners!
    Since my drives have been unpredictable lately I’m going for a lesson with an instructor I trust (who also recommends adding a stroke to each hole) to see if he can give me some pointers.
